Bredbury Blue Posted October 30, 2018 Share Posted October 30, 2018 Took a while to get used to watching that game with all the bloody NFL lines, but after a while the lines across the pitch were useful, and i wish to thank Spurs for educating me in how wide a NFL pitch is (it's very narrow) compared to a football pitch. Thought first half we were excellent and second half we laboured a little having not killed the game off when we should have. We created plenty of chances but were wasteful, but pleasing to see we gave few chances away to Spurs in our half - the defence seems to be doing well this season to date. Loved Ederson's block tackle on Harry, and his long passes down field continue to surprise me as much as our opponents - does any other goalie kick it as far with as much accuracy? Cracking goal from Sterling who burnt Trippier for pace and trickery and it was a great 55 metre run from Mahrez to get in the box and finish nicely. Silva, La Porte, Stones, Ederson, Sterling and Mahrez were all decent or excellent and Fernandinho was really back to form last night - really enjoyed his performance last night as the pantomine villain. Mahrez these past games is now looking like the player we thought we'd bought (as the guardian says "Mahrez always seemed to be free, jinking always to his left, a jink so well advertised one half expected it to pop up on the scrolling boards at the side of the pitch in shiny flashing text, but which somehow nobody ever really seems to expect."). Sterling looked dangerous throughout the game - Trippier doesn't like pacey players does he and has struggled against Sane and Sterling. LaPorte is now looking the business and Stones kept Harry under control. Mendy was an absolute nightmare - must have cut 20M off his own valuation, he was that bad. Good at the 'air kick' though. Needs to sort himself out or he'll be shipped out. Sure Delph would have been on at halftime if he'd been on the bench. Well worth going to bed at 9pm and getting up at 3am. Bredbury Blue Posted October 31, 2018 Share Posted October 31, 2018 CARMINE: "Guardiola felt confident enough to leave de Br u yne and San e too i believe, on the bench, a decision that the likes of Liverpool and Chelsea sho uld find somewhat disturbing." KdB was left on the bench as he's not fully match fit as shown by his very rusty performance when he came on. Sane has been pushed out of the team by Pep continuing to bed Mahrez in which requires Sterling to play left side. There is also the feeling that Sane and Mendy don't work well together. I'm sure neither Liverpool nor Chelsea are disturbed one bit by City's performances and both fancy their chances, rightly so, it's anybodies to win.
